Join the Haitian Roundtable and the NYU McSilver Institute to celebrate the launch of a powerful new memoir by renowned political strategist Karine Jean-Pierre. Moving Forward is an inspiring memoir and call to action which chronicles her experiences—from growing up in New York’s Haitian community to working in the Obama White House and charting a path for others to help change the face of politics. Vladimir Duthiers, Peabody Award-Winning Journalist and Correspondent for CBS News and CBS This Morning will lead this fireside chat with the author.
